Climate-based fiscal and monetary policies for low-carbon growth in Nigeria
Queen Esther Oye, Dominic E. Azuh
This study uses an environmental DSGE model for Nigeria to analyze carbon tax, green subsidies, and green relending policies. An unexpected carbon tax is recessionary while subsidies and relending are expansionary; proper sequencing is key.

Climate change mitigation through industrial Spirulina culture: a multifaceted approach for carbon sequestration and recovery of value added pigment phycocyanin
S.W. Belsare, Sonam Shukla, K. Kumar +3
This study evaluates carbon sequestration and phycocyanin recovery from industrial Spirulina biomass. Estimated annual CO2 sequestration is 176 tonnes, and phycocyanin extraction offers up to 41% additional revenue. The biorefinery model de…
